Detective Branch (DB) officials freed two suspected Pahela Baishakh sex offenders and a woman after recording their statements under section 54 on Tuesday night.
Requesting anonymity, a high official of DB, the lead investigators of the case, said that a few days ago two young men and a woman, came to their office and claimed that they were trying to save their friends during the incident. The woman who claimed herself as a victim of the attack said the two men were her friends and
 they came to know about the matter through newspapers. At least 20 women were reported to have been sexually assaulted when they were returning home after celebrating Pahela Baishakh on the Dhaka University campus on April 14.
Meanwhile, State Minister for Home Asaduzzaman Khan Kamal backed tracked from his statement which was delivered on Monday in the Parliament over the arrest of assaulters on Monday.
In a press briefing at the Home Ministry on Tuesday, he said that police had not arrested any identified molester yet.
However on Monday, the minister said in the parliament that several culprits of the Pohela Boishakh assault on women had been arrested, although police said they had not yet made any arrests in this connection.
Kamal said that the three suspects who visited the DB office were sent to the court under section 54 of Bangladesh Penal Code. They were freed after being testified. They identified eight wrongdoers after analysing the video footage of the CCTV cameras at Dhaka University.
 Now the number of suspects had come down to six, said the high official of DB.
